Asbury Park Women’s Convention Joins Forces Again For “BANS OFF OUR BODIES”

Asbury Park women’s organization will be hosting the event to raise money and awareness for reproductive rights

By Asbury Park Sun
Tweet



On Saturday July 9 at 4 pm, the Asbury Park Women’s Convention will hold a rally to fight for reproductive rights in Springwood Park in Asbury Park, according to a news release from the organization. The Asbury Park Women’s Convention (APWC), co-founded in 2017 by Asbury Park Deputy Mayor Amy Quinn and Jess Alaimo, will […]

APWC 3 – Inspired & On The Move Set For March 15

Third Annual Event Celebrates City’s Women-Owned & Operated City Businesses

By Asbury Park Sun
Tweet



ASBURY PARK —  After two successful and historic events, organizers behind the annual Asbury Park Women’s Convention are keeping the conversation going with APWC 3: Inspired And On The Move. The third annual celebration is scheduled for the weekend of Saturday and Sunday, March 14-15, 2020 in Asbury Park’s thriving downtown district to honor female-owned […]

BOE Election Candidates Forum Will Be Held Weds At Trinity

Submit questions for the six vying for three seats by 8 p.m. Tuesday

By Michelle Gladden
Tweet



The Westside Citizens United, in cooperation Trinity Episcopal Church, will host an Asbury Park School Board Election Candidate’s Forum from 6 to 8 p.m. Wednesday. Six candidates are vying for three available three-year seats. They include, in order of ballot position: • James Famularo of Park Ave, a former BOE member and former city employee […]

NOTICE: Fake Asbury Park Sun website has no connection to this site or its employees


By Dan Jacobson
Tweet



There is a website that has copied the exact look of asburyparksun.com with fake stories. Some of the posts include fake profane quotes of public officials and others. One public official was recently contacted by a statewide news outlet about an outrageous quote that they thought was on the Asbury Park Sun, but was actually […]
